About Cat Claw Covers And The Benefits It Bring

Clawing, or scratching at the furniture is a normal habit for cats. They do this since it feels good to them. However, several cat owners are not quite happy with the result--torn up couches, scratched drapes, and far more. It can be hard to train a cat to quit doing such things, so many cat owners feel they have no choice but to declaw their cats.

There is another option-- cat claw covers. These are vinyl tips that are applied and glued onto the cat's nails, leaving them with a more softer end. These are also sometimes called claw caps.

One amongst the most popular brands of cat claw covers are Soft Paws. They make these in various sizes, so you can use them on very small cats, up to dogs. To apply them, you just have to fill the cap with glue, after which quickly put it onto your cat's claw. Hold it there for a few seconds so the glue can set. These will remain on for between four and six weeks. They will naturally fall off when the cat's claws grow, therefore you do not need to worry about removing them.

It may take a while for your cat to get used to having these on their claws. The first couple days they have them on, they may nip at them, or try to get them off. They may even remove one or two or swallow one. Once they do this, never worry, they are non toxic and will not hurt the cat. Simply check the cats paws every day or two to make sure that they are still on. If they aren't simply apply a new one.

In the event that your cat does not like its paws touched, which is quite common, you probably may not wish to apply these by yourself. Seek the help of a friend, or have your veterinarian to undertake it. Many will do it for a small fee.
